About 8 Essex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

8 Essex Road is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Chadwell Heath, Romford, Romford (RM6 4JA). It has a recorded floor area of 96 m² (around 1033 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(February 2023)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 3 certificates since November 2008.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 87), a 2-band jump. Period features are noted in the property record.

It hasn't traded since November 2003, a hold of 23 years that's notably long for the area. At 96 m² the property is well over the postcode median (66 m² across 37 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 2001–2003, sale prices on this property compounded at 19.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£494,000 sits 143.3% above the 2003 sale of £203,000.
